Abstract
Because the studies in our laboratory and the work of other investigators of the effect of color on the absorption of the laser energy, patients with melanomas early in the course of our clinical investigative studies were treated. The initial experiments were done by impacts of the laser of freshly excised deeply pigmented melanoma tissue. In addition, cytological material from ulcerative melanomas was exposed to unfocussed laser beams of low energy laser impact of 0.2–0.5 joules and the selective destruction of the melanoma tumor cells was found.
